Effects of the viscous dissipation on the Darcy-Brinkman flow: rigorous derivation of the higher-order asymptotic model

We consider the non-isothermal fluid flow through a thin domain occupied by a saturated porous medium. The flow is governed by the Darcy-Brinkman system and the heat equation including the viscous dissipation term proposed by Al- Hadhrami et al. (2003). Using asymptotic analysis with respect to domain's thickness, a second-order asymptotic approximation of the problem is built. The formally derived model is rigorously justified via error estimate.
